Commercial Slab Installation in Columbus, OH
Commercial slab installation services involve preparing and pouring concrete foundations for a variety of property projects, including warehouses, retail spaces, garages, driveways, and loading docks. This process provides a durable, level surface essential for supporting heavy equipment, vehicles, or foot traffic.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of the work, including site preparation, concrete specifications, and the importance of proper reinforcement to ensure longevity and stability. Clarifying these details helps ensure the project meets the specific needs of the space and provides a reliable foundation for future use.
Before requesting commercial slab installation, property owners should consider factors such as the size and layout of the area, soil conditions, and any necessary permits or regulations in Columbus, OH. It’s also helpful to understand the expected load requirements and drainage considerations to prevent future issues. Proper planning and clear communication about these elements can contribute to a successful installation that supports the property's intended function and withstands local environmental conditions.

Commercial Slab Installation Questions
What types of projects require a commercial slab installation? Commercial slab installations are often used for building foundations, parking lots, loading docks, and storage areas on commercial properties in Columbus, OH.
What materials are commonly used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the most common material for commercial slabs due to its durability and strength, suitable for heavy loads and high traffic areas.
How should property owners prepare for a commercial slab installation? Proper site preparation includes clearing the area, ensuring proper drainage, and verifying soil stability to support the slab effectively.
What maintenance is needed after a commercial slab is installed? Routine inspections for cracks or damage and keeping the surface clean help maintain the slab’s integrity over time.
